The Historical and Systemic Evolution of Tropical Plein Air

Tropical painting destinations usa the American fascination with painting the tropics began in earnest during the late 19th century. Figures like Winslow Homer and John Singer Sargent shifted the artistic gaze toward the Gulf Stream and the Caribbean, seeking to escape the tonalist constraints of the Northeast. This wasn’t just a change in subject matter; it was a revolution in color theory.

Systemically, the development of the Florida East Coast Railway and the eventual inclusion of Hawaii and Puerto Rico as U.S. territories transformed these once-inaccessible regions into viable professional circuits. The “winter colony” phenomenon in places like Key West or St. Augustine created a feedback loop where artists influenced the development of the destinations themselves, turning them into established centers for light-centric painting.

Conceptual Frameworks: The Physics of Light and Humidity

To effectively navigate these regions, artists utilize several mental models to adjust their technique to the environment:

  • The Atmospheric Refraction Model: In tropical regions, higher moisture content in the air scatters light differently than in arid climates. This creates “atmospheric perspective” over shorter distances, where distant palms may appear significantly bluer or paler than those in the foreground.

  • The High-Chroma Saturation Limit: The intensity of tropical sunlight can actually “wash out” color to the human eye. Artists must learn to distinguish between the local color of an object and the perceived color under a 90-degree sun angle.

  • The Evaporation Differential: This is a material science framework. In high-humidity tropical zones, watercolor dries at a fraction of the speed it does in Arizona. Conversely, the intense heat can cause oil paint “skins” to form prematurely.

  • The Diurnal Light Shift: Unlike the long “golden hours” of northern latitudes, the transition from dawn to full sun and from dusk to night in the tropics is exceptionally rapid. The window for capturing specific light effects is compressed, requiring a “speed-over-detail” workflow.

Detailed Real-World Scenarios Tropical Painting Destinations Usa for the Working Artist

Scenario A: The Remote Hawaiian Trek

An oil painter intends to capture the interior rainforests of Kauai.

  • Constraints: High rainfall (Waiʻaleʻale is one of the wettest spots on earth), dense canopy, and high humidity.

  • Decision Point: Traditional heavy wooden easels are a liability. The artist must opt for a lightweight carbon-fiber setup and “fast-dry” mediums like Galkyd to ensure sketches are transportable within 24 hours.

  • Failure Mode: Failure to use anti-fungal additives in storage containers can lead to mold growth on canvases before they even return to the mainland.

Scenario B: The Florida Keys Mid-Summer

A watercolorist seeks the turquoise waters of Dry Tortugas National Park.

  • Constraints: Intense heat (), zero shade, and high salt spray.

  • Logic: The salt in the air can affect the “wash” of watercolors, creating unexpected textures. The artist must use distilled water for their palette rather than local tap water to maintain chemical purity.

  • Second-Order Effect: The high glare off the white coral sand necessitates the use of neutral-grey sunglasses that do not distort color perception, or the resulting paintings will be inadvertently over-saturated.

Strategies and Support Systems for Fieldwork Tropical Painting Destinations Usa

Success in these environments depends on a “Tactical Plein Air” mindset:

  1. UV-Stabilized Umbrellas: Not for rain, but to create a “neutral light” workspace on the canvas, preventing the sun from skewing color choices.

  2. Sealed Solvent Containers: In heat, solvents evaporate rapidly and become volatile; high-quality gaskets are non-negotiable.

  3. Dehumidification Kits: For traveling artists, “Dri-Z-Air” or silica gel packets in canvas carriers are essential to prevent moisture entrapment.

  4. Local Knowledge Networks: Engaging with local “Plein Air” groups provides critical data on tide times and “bug hatches”—factors that can end a session in minutes.

  5. Polarizing Filters: Using a handheld polarizer to “read” the water’s depths before painting helps the artist understand the subsurface topography they are attempting to render.

Risk Landscape: Environmental and Material Challenges

The tropics are chemically and physically aggressive toward art materials.

  • Photochemical Degradation: The UV index in the U.S. Virgin Islands can be double that of the Midwest. Even “permanent” pigments may fade if not protected by high-quality UV-varnish.

  • Salt-Air Crystallization: Salt can settle on a wet oil painting, becoming embedded in the film. Over years, this salt can attract moisture (hygroscopy), leading to structural failure of the paint layer.

  • The Biological Factor: Insects (notably “no-see-ums” and mosquitoes) are not just a nuisance; they can become physically stuck in the paint, requiring surgical removal that compromises the surface texture.

  • Rapid Weather Shifts: A “clear” tropical sky can produce a localized squall in under ten minutes. A plan that doesn’t include a “five-minute pack-up” strategy is fundamentally flawed.

Maintenance of Art and Gear in High-Stress Climates Tropical Painting Destinations Usa

Maintenance in tropical zones follows a “Pre-emptive and Post-session” cycle:

  • Gear Rinse: Every piece of metal gear (easel legs, palette knives) must be wiped with fresh water daily to prevent salt-induced pitting.

  • Canvas Tension: High humidity causes canvas to sag. Artists should use “keys” (the small wooden wedges in the corners of stretchers) to tighten the surface after the painting has equilibrated to the environment.

  • Storage Governance: Finished works should never be stored in “dead air” spaces (like a closet) in the tropics. Airflow is the primary defense against “foxing” (brown spots on paper) and mold.

Common Misconceptions and Oversimplifications Tropical Painting Destinations Usa

  1. “It’s always sunny”: Tropical regions have intense “cloud days” that offer a unique, soft, high-key light that is often more interesting than a clear blue sky.

  2. “You need a ‘tropical’ palette”: You don’t need new colors; you need to understand how to mix your existing pigments to reach higher saturations without becoming “chalky.”

  3. “Florida is the same everywhere”: The light in the “Deep Glades” (tannin-stained, dark water) is the polar opposite of the light in the “Lower Keys” (white sand, turquoise water).
